The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Kazakhstan, in partnership with Kazakhstan’s Chief Editors’ Club, is delighted to announce the opening of applications for the 9th edition of the “Kazakhstan through the Eyes of Foreign Media” contest. This contest invites foreign journalists to submit their written or filmed works showcasing diverse aspects of Kazakhstan.

Applications for works about Kazakhstan (analytical, cultural-entertainment, documentary, etc.) that were published in foreign media or on social networks between August 1, 2023, and August 1, 2024, are now being accepted for the contest.

The winners will be awarded a trip to Kazakhstan, including visits to the cities of Astana, Almaty, and the Mangystau region, where they will enjoy a rich cultural program.

n addition to the primary categories, this year introduces new nominations initiated by “KazAID” and Kazakhstan’s National Sports Association, with each awarding two winners.

According to the competition results, five winners from five geographical areas will be determined:

  • North and South America;
  • Europe;
  • CIS countries;
  • Middle East & Africa;
  • Asia-Pacific region,

and four laureates in the nominations for tourism, CICA, “KazAID,” and national sports.

Additionally, in keeping with established tradition, the meetings with representatives of the public sector, experts, journalists, scientists, and cultural figures of Kazakhstan will be specially organized for the laureates of the competition.
